ICD-10 Code Q03.9: Congenital hydrocephalus, unspecified

Q03.9 is a billable ICD-10 diagnosis code used to classify Congenital hydrocephalus, unspecified in medical records and claims. You may see this code in hospital records, discharge summaries, insurance claims, encounter documentation, referrals, or other healthcare billing and coding records. ICD-10 codes are diagnosis classification codes used in healthcare records, reporting, coding workflows, and billing support. This code sits within the broader ICD-10 area for Congenital malformations, deformations, chromosomal abnormalities, and genetic disorders (Q00-QA0).
